Live Audio Coverage from the ESCRS Congress in Berlin

Article

Dr Douglas D. Koch talks about indications and options related to accommodating lenses, Dr Thomas F. Neuhann discusses why he prefers the femtosecond laser to the mechanical microkeratome when making LASIK flaps and Dr Jack T. Holladaytalks about using a laser versus implanting an inlay to treat presbyopia to provide good distance vision and allow patients to read without glasses or contact lenses.
